Yesterday lots of PS
Vita game localization was announced. Fans of Danganronpa Series will get their
3rd installment this September. V3 is a brand new Danganronpa game which is not
connected to 1 and 2.The game will feature both English and Japanese voiceovers.
Fans in Japan have requested to have the voices patched for better sound.
According to Gematsu, A limited edition will be launched via NIS Store, $99.00
for the PS4 version then $79.00 for the PS Vita. My wife and I are both fans of

YS VIII: Lacrimosa
of Dana announcement is a surprise as well as we are all waiting for years to
have this game localized. If your fan of YS you'll definitely want to check
this out. An upgraded PS4 version of YS VIII will be released alongside the
Vita version. YSVIII will be relased for PS4, PS VITA and PC this fall.
Another announcement, if you’re a fan of First Person RPG's get excited now because Operation Babel is going to be released for PS VITA this May. Operation Babel is connected to Operation Abyss so if your familiar with the Labyrinth style of the first one you'll definitely enjoy the game.
